[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[taler-merchant] branch master updated: database schema update for #8638
From: |
gnunet |
Subject: |
[taler-merchant] branch master updated: database schema update for #8638 |
Date: |
Mon, 18 Mar 2024 23:46:02 +0100 |
This is an automated email from the git hooks/post-receive script.
grothoff pushed a commit to branch master
in repository merchant.
The following commit(s) were added to refs/heads/master by this push:
new ef892786 database schema update for #8638
ef892786 is described below
commit ef8927863d6f39098c1c68bbc0bf8a36319caccf
Author: Christian Grothoff <christian@grothoff.org>
AuthorDate: Mon Mar 18 23:45:58 2024 +0100
database schema update for #8638
---
src/backenddb/merchant-0005.sql | 13 +++++++++++--
1 file changed, 11 insertions(+), 2 deletions(-)
diff --git a/src/backenddb/merchant-0005.sql b/src/backenddb/merchant-0005.sql
index b7bf4c91..a356f6da 100644
--- a/src/backenddb/merchant-0005.sql
+++ b/src/backenddb/merchant-0005.sql
@@ -1,6 +1,6 @@
--
-- This file is part of TALER
--- Copyright (C) 2023 Taler Systems SA
+-- Copyright (C) 2024 Taler Systems SA
--
-- TALER is free software; you can redistribute it and/or modify it under the
-- terms of the GNU General Public License as published by the Free Software
@@ -18,10 +18,19 @@
BEGIN;
-- Check patch versioning is in place.
--- SELECT _v.register_patch('merchant-0005', NULL, NULL);
+SELECT _v.register_patch('merchant-0005', NULL, NULL);
SET search_path TO merchant;
+ALTER TABLE merchant_template
+ ADD COLUMN required_currency VARCHAR(12) DEFAULT NULL,
+ ADD COLUMN editable_defaults TEXT DEFAULT NULL;
+
+COMMENT ON COLUMN merchant_template.required_currency
+ IS 'currency that the amount to be paid entered by the user must be in; if
not given and the amount is not fixed in the template contract, the user may
edit the currency';
+COMMENT ON COLUMN merchant_template.editable_defaults
+ IS 'JSON object with fields matching the template contract, just with
default values that are editable by the user';
+
-- Complete transaction
COMMIT;
--
To stop receiving notification emails like this one, please contact
gnunet@gnunet.org.
[Prev in Thread] |
Current Thread |
[Next in Thread] |
- [taler-merchant] branch master updated: database schema update for #8638,
gnunet <=